Output 672336a5b3e10516b6603d51ec87d73ae54b3c596b2eb2dae32905fb0effe428:0

value
184409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d70afcf3b51908e50412bd189beb3898f9ed91e OP_EQUAL
address
3Qo5sgy7CteLvRy124dnYV7KuXVtRrQ7hi
transaction
672336a5b3e10516b6603d51ec87d73ae54b3c596b2eb2dae32905fb0effe428
confirmations
284854
spent
true